Nevada's state sales-tax base rate is 6.85 percent (local additions vary), and on most deals the tax rolls into the financed amount rather than coming out of pocket. The UCC-1 securing the equipment gets filed with the Nevada Secretary of State, and we handle that filing at funding. Nevada has no state income tax, so Section 179 and depreciation decisions play out on your federal return only. Full state-level detail lives on our Nevada guide.

Structure choice: loan, EFA, or lease
For North Las Vegas, NV buyers: Practice acquisitions often bundle equipment into the deal, which we finance as straight equipment paper. Nevada has no state income tax, so Section 179 and depreciation decisions play out on your federal return only.
$1 buyout EFA
Equipment Finance Agreement structured as a loan with a $1 purchase option at end of term. Functionally identical to a loan for tax and ownership purposes; documentation is slightly simpler and faster to close. The most common structure on app-only veterinary financing under $250K in North Las Vegas, NV.
Equipment loan
Traditional secured loan. You own the veterinary equipment from day one; we hold a UCC-1 filing until payoff. Standard depreciation treatment for taxes, with common terms of 36-84 months depending on useful life. The best fit for North Las Vegas, NV buyers planning to keep the equipment past the financing term.
Fair-market-value (FMV) lease
True operating lease on veterinary equipment. Payments deduct fully as business expense; at end of term you can purchase at fair market value, return the equipment, or extend. Best fit for North Las Vegas, NV operators cycling equipment every 36-48 months or when operating-lease tax treatment matters.
Common pitfalls on veterinary financing
The patterns below show up regularly on veterinary equipment financing transactions across North Las Vegas, NV. Catching any of them at the application or document-review stage saves real money and avoids post-funding disputes.
Section 179 requires the veterinary equipment placed in service by December 31 of the tax year. Delivery without commissioning doesn't count for some equipment classes. Document the placed-in-service date carefully.
Dealers commonly quote a bundled veterinary price including buckets, forks, plates, or specialty attachments, but the bill of sale lists only the base unit. We fund what is on the bill of sale; itemize every attachment line by line before signing.
